Supporting Girls in their Transition to Secondary Education: An Exploratory Study of the Family, School, and Community Environments of Adolescent Girls in Gujarat

Authoring Agencies: Population Council and CHETNAPublication Date: 2014This study, drawing on a baseline survey conducted in 90 villages in Surendranagar district in Gujarat, explored the school experiences of adolescent girls in the last year of primary school and the first year of secondary school. It assessed the extent to which a supportive environment for schooling was available to these girls […]

Walking Prey: How America’s Youth are Vulnerable to Sex Slavery Voices Against Violence Curriculum

Author: Holly Austin SmithPublication Date: 2014Walking Prey is an academic non-fiction book about the commercial sexual exploitation of children (CSEC), including child sex trafficking, in the United States.  The book discusses predisposing factors to CSEC, community risk factors, and how to engage with victim advocates, healthcare providers, and law enforcement. Making Your Health Services Youth-Friendly: A Guide for Program Planners and Implementers

Authoring Agencies: Population Services International, IntraHealth International, and USAIDPublication Date: 2014The guide provides an overview of the global need for youth-friendly service provision and key recommendations for developing/strengthening sexual and reproductive health (SRH) services so that providers are better able to engage and retain young people in care.
